No, there is no direct bus from London Victoria Station to St Merryn. However, there are services departing from London Victoria Station station and arriving at St Merryn station via Dennison Road Car Park.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 11h 52m.
London Victoria Station to St Merryn bus services, operated by National Express, depart from London Victoria station.
London Victoria Station to St Merryn bus services, operated by National Express, arrive at Dennison Road Car Park station.
The distance between London Victoria Station and St Merryn is 355.7 km. The road distance is 446 km.
National Express operates a bus from London Victoria to Dennison Road Car Park every 4 hours. Tickets cost £45–120 and the journey takes 6h 40m.
